Why Aviation & Maritime Waste Incineration is Critical
International catering waste (ICW) and cargo waste from flights and maritime vessels carry high risks of introducing foreign pests and diseases. On-site incineration at airports and seaports provides immediate, secure destruction of this high-risk waste, strictly adhering to international biosecurity mandates and protecting local agriculture and ecosystems.
